Output e2223fe33f8dcb7a78a5b751fe95ae57deae80722957eb34e530e43ac1f4e89a:0

value
479820735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d0530446526e2c27e16d3564f3164d3ad2ace66 OP_EQUAL
address
38iGApaBxVzEtaAvE63zbvaJkT9JwjeYqs
transaction
e2223fe33f8dcb7a78a5b751fe95ae57deae80722957eb34e530e43ac1f4e89a
spent
true